Q: Is 31,000,018 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 31,000,018 is not a prime number.

Why is 31,000,018 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 31000018 can be evenly divided by 1 2 7 14 41 53 82 106 287 371 574 742 1,019 2,038 2,173 4,346 7,133 14,266 15,211 30,422 41,779 54,007 83,558 108,014 292,453 378,049 584,906 756,098 2,214,287 4,428,574 15,500,009 and 31,000,018, with no remainder.

Since 31,000,018 cannot be divided by just 1 and 31,000,018, it is not a prime number.
